Latest Recipes4 lb pork spare ribs
1 cup brown sugar
1/4 cup ketchup
1/4 cup soy sauce
1/4 cup Worcestershire sauce
1/4 cup rum
1/2 cup chili sauce
2 clove garlic, crushed
1 teaspoon dry mustard
1 dash ground black pepper
1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Cut spareribs into serving size portions, wrap in double thickness of foil, and bake for 1 1/2 hours. Unwrap and drain drippings. Place ribs in a large roasting pan.
2. In a bowl, mix together brown sugar, ketchup, soy sauce, Worcestershire sauce, rum, chile sauce, garlic, mustard, and pepper. Coat ribs with sauce and marinate at room temperature for 1 hour or refrigerate overnight.
3. Preheat grill for medium heat. Position grate 4" above heat source.
4. Brush grill grate with oil. Place ribs on grill and cook for 30 minutes, basting with marinade.
**I don't cut the ribs into bite size pieces before cooking in the oven or grill. I cut them into pieces after all of the marinating and cooking**
